John Jay vs. Manhattan School of Music

Both CUNY John Jay College of Criminal Justice and Manhattan School of Music are 4 years schools located in New York. The following statements compare CUNY John Jay College of Criminal Justice and Manhattan School of Music with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Manhattan School of Music's tuition ($54,600) is more expensive than John Jay ($15,420).
  • John Jay's acceptance rate (50.66%) is lower than Manhattan School of Music (55.01%).
  • Manhattan School of Music has higher yield (27.26%) than John Jay (19.64%).
  • Manhattan School of Music's students to faculty ratio (6 to 1) is lower than John Jay (16 to 1).
  • John Jay (13,921 students) is larger than Manhattan School of Music (1,115 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Manhattan School of Music ($24,804) has higher amount of financial aid than John Jay ($7,275).
  • Manhattan School of Music's graduation rate (79%) is higher than John Jay (53%).
